Granblue Fantasy: Versus – Knickknack Shack Showcased in New Video

The item shop is your ticket for getting geared up in RPG Mode.

Despite being based on a mobile RPG, Cygames’ Granblue Fantasy: Versus is a fighting game first and foremost. However, along with the standard fighting modes, this Arc System Works-developed title also sports RPG Mode. It essentially offers a side-scrolling beat ’em up experience with bosses and items.

How do you go about obtaining items like weapons and the like? By visiting Sierokarte’s Knickknack Shack. The official Granblue Fantasy: Versus Twitter offered a short gameplay clip on how this looks. Completing different quests will also reward weapons and items so there are multiple avenues for progression.

Granblue Fantasy: Versus is out on February 6th for PS4 in Japan. Western audiences can expect to pick it up in the first quarter of this year though a definite release date hasn’t been confirmed.
